Cape grows steady pile of confiscated cellphones
22 July 2015 - 02:03
Cape Town traffic authorities have confiscated 9465 cellphones from motorists since new bylaws were introduced in 2012 - an average of 3155 a year. The bylaw, which allows Metro cops to impound cellphones when they find motorists using them while driving, allows drivers to reclaim their phones after 24 hours.
